    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Louisa Close last sold in August 2001 for £46,000. Based on price growth in the E9 district since then, its estimated current value is £176,123 — placing it in the 18th percentile nationally and the 2nd percentile within E9. The property covers 93 m² (1,001 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,894 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— E9

    E9 covers Hackney and parts of surrounding areas in northeast London. It is a diverse, densely populated district with strong cultural vibrancy and a young, professionally-oriented population.
